Linux查找软件的安装路径方法

一、查看软件安装路径:


Linux软件安装的地方不止一个地方,先说查看软件安装的所有路径(地址)。

这里以Mysql为例。比如说我安装了Mysql,但是不知道文件都安装在哪些地方、放在哪些文件夹里,可以用下面的命令查看所有的文件路径

在终端输入:

whereis mysql 
回车,如果你安装好了Mysql,就会显示文件安装的地址,例如我的显示(安装地址可能会不同)

mysql: /usr/bin/mysql /usr/lib/mysql /usr/share/mysql /usr/share/man/man1/mysql.1.gz 
可以看出来,mysql安装在这些目录里。

如果你没有安装mysql,则不会显示文件路径出来。

二、查询运行文件所在路径:

如果你只要查询文件的运行文件所在地址,直接用下面的命令就可以了(还是以Mysql为例):

which mysql 
结果会显示:

/usr/bin/mysql
### 查找 OpenCV 安装路径方法Linux 系统中,可以通过多种方式查找 OpenCV 的安装路径。以下是一些常用的方法: #### 使用 `pkg-config` 工具 如果 OpenCV 是通过 `pkg-config` 安装的,可以使用以下命令来获取安装路径: ```bash pkg-config --variable=prefix opencv ``` 该命令会输出 OpenCV 的安装目录,通常为 `/usr/local` 或 `/usr`。 #### 查看 OpenCV 的头文件路径 OpenCV 的头文件通常安装在 `/usr/local/include/opencv4` 或 `/usr/include/opencv` 等目录下。可以通过以下命令检查是否存在这些目录: ```bash ls /usr/local/include/opencv4 ``` 如果 OpenCV 已经正确安装,这些目录中应该包含 OpenCV 的头文件[^1]。 #### 查找 OpenCV 的库文件路径 OpenCV 的库文件通常位于 `/usr/local/lib` 或 `/usr/lib` 目录下。可以使用以下命令查找库文件: ```bash find /usr/local/lib -name "libopencv*" ``` 该命令将列出所有与 OpenCV 相关的库文件,帮助确认 OpenCV 是否已正确安装[^1]。 #### 使用 `cmake` 配置文件 如果 OpenCV 是通过源码编译安装的,可以在编译时指定安装路径。例如,在 `CMakeLists.txt` 文件中设置 OpenCV 的路径: ```cmake set(OpenCV_DIR "/home/username/opencv-4.5.0/build") ``` 这样可以指定特定版本的 OpenCV 进行编译,避免不同版本之间的冲突[^2]。 #### 修改环境变量 为了确保系统能够正确识别 OpenCV 的库文件,可能需要修改环境变量 `PKG_CONFIG_PATH`,使其包含 OpenCV 的 `.pc` 文件路径: ```bash export PKG_CONFIG_PATH=/usr/local/lib/pkgconfig:$PKG_CONFIG_PATH ``` 此命令将 OpenCV 的库路径添加到 `PKG_CONFIG_PATH` 中,以便 `pkg-config` 能够正确识别库路径[^3]。 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值